CA2164269A1 - Image processing in which the image is divided into image areas with specific color lookup tables for enhanced color resolution - Google Patents

Image processing in which the image is divided into image areas with specific color lookup tables for enhanced color resolution

Info

Publication number
CA2164269A1
CA2164269A1 CA002164269A CA2164269A CA2164269A1 CA 2164269 A1 CA2164269 A1 CA 2164269A1 CA 002164269 A CA002164269 A CA 002164269A CA 2164269 A CA2164269 A CA 2164269A CA 2164269 A1 CA2164269 A1 CA 2164269A1
Authority
CA
Canada
Prior art keywords
image
data
color
divided
image data
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
CA002164269A
Other languages
French (fr)
Other versions
CA2164269C (en
Inventor
Masayoshi Tanaka
Masakazu Suzuoki
Toyoshi Okada
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Sony Interactive Entertainment Inc
Original Assignee
Masayoshi Tanaka
Masakazu Suzuoki
Toyoshi Okada
Sony Corporation
Sony Computer Entertainment Inc.
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Masayoshi Tanaka, Masakazu Suzuoki, Toyoshi Okada, Sony Corporation, Sony Computer Entertainment Inc. filed Critical Masayoshi Tanaka
Publication of CA2164269A1 publication Critical patent/CA2164269A1/en
Application granted granted Critical
Publication of CA2164269C publication Critical patent/CA2164269C/en
Anticipated expiration legal-status Critical
Expired - Lifetime leg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T1/00General purpose image data processing
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T11/002D [Two Dimensional] image generation
    • G06T11/001Texturing; Colouring; Generation of texture or colour

Abstract

There are provided a geometry transfer engine (GTE) 61 and a graphic processing unit (GPU 62) which act in combination as a transforming means for converting three-dimensional image data retrieved from a CD-ROM disk into two-dimensional image data for drawing an image on a two-dimensional display screen, and a frame buffer 63 which serves as a memory having an image data storage area (picture data area) for storage of the image data and at least a color data tables storage area (CLUT area) for storage of multiple color lookup data tables in a two-dimensional arrangement, each color data table including a color data wherein the structure is arranged substantially identical to that of each pixel of data in the image. A greater number of colors are thus facilitated and the data processing is simplified.
CA002164269A 1994-12-02 1995-12-01 Image processing in which the image is divided into image areas with specific color lookup tables for enhanced color resolution Expired - Lifetime CA2164269C (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
JPPO6-300029 1994-12-02
JP30002994 1994-12-02

Publications (2)

Publication Number Publication Date
CA2164269A1 true CA2164269A1 (en) 1996-06-03
CA2164269C CA2164269C (en) 2008-02-12

Family

ID=17879856

Family Applications (1)

Application Number Title Priority Date Filing Date
CA002164269A Expired - Lifetime CA2164269C (en) 1994-12-02 1995-12-01 Image processing in which the image is divided into image areas with specific color lookup tables for enhanced color resolution

Country Status (6)

Country Link
US (1) US5949409A (en)
EP (1) EP0715279B1 (en)
KR (1) KR100392808B1 (en)
CN (1) CN1136517C (en)
AT (1) ATE281675T1 (en)
CA (1) CA2164269C (en)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N110660029A (en) * 2019-09-12 2020-01-07 深兰科技(上海)有限公司 Image processing method, device, equipment and storage medium

Families Citing this family (60)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B9507258D0 (en) * 1995-04-07 1995-05-31 Pandora Int Ltd Data handling systems
JPH09114591A (en) * 1995-10-12 1997-05-02 Semiconductor Energy Lab Co Ltd Liquid crystal display and its display method
US6331856B1 (en) * 1995-11-22 2001-12-18 Nintendo Co., Ltd. Video game system with coprocessor providing high speed efficient 3D graphics and digital audio signal processing
KR100203264B1 (en) * 1996-06-29 1999-06-15 윤종용 Method and device for subpicture decoding in a digital video disc system
CN1062362C (en) * 1997-04-15 2001-02-21 英业达股份有限公司 Dynamic linking method for computer image
US6313847B1 (en) * 1997-12-22 2001-11-06 Adobe Systems Incorporated Blending graphics objects in a frame buffer
US6084595A (en) * 1998-02-24 2000-07-04 Virage, Inc. Indexing method for image search engine
US6745390B1 (en) * 1998-03-12 2004-06-01 United Video Properties, Inc. Palette management for display of regular graphic objects
US6404909B2 (en) * 1998-07-16 2002-06-11 General Electric Company Method and apparatus for processing partial lines of scanned images
US6166724A (en) * 1998-10-05 2000-12-26 Ati International Srl Method and apparatus for sequencing palette updates in a video graphics system
JP2000235382A (en) * 1998-12-18 2000-08-29 Sony Corp Device and method for processing picture
US6804683B1 (en) * 1999-11-25 2004-10-12 Olympus Corporation Similar image retrieving apparatus, three-dimensional image database apparatus and method for constructing three-dimensional image database
US6807620B1 (en) 2000-02-11 2004-10-19 Sony Computer Entertainment Inc. Game system with graphics processor
US6721000B1 (en) 2000-02-23 2004-04-13 Neomagic Corp. Adaptive pixel-level color enhancement for a digital camera
US7091985B1 (en) * 2000-05-16 2006-08-15 International Business Machines Corporation System and method for compressing color data using expandable color palette
US6734866B1 (en) * 2000-09-28 2004-05-11 Rockwell Automation Technologies, Inc. Multiple adapting display interface
JP2002218345A (en) * 2001-01-16 2002-08-02 Mitsubishi Electric Corp Screen display device
EP1235437A1 (en) * 2001-02-26 2002-08-28 Deutsche Thomson-Brandt Gmbh Method for recording or reproduction of sub-picture data accompanying video signals, corresponding apparatus, signal and data carrier
US7681112B1 (en) 2003-05-30 2010-03-16 Adobe Systems Incorporated Embedded reuse meta information
US7248265B2 (en) * 2004-04-16 2007-07-24 Apple Inc. System and method for processing graphics operations with graphics processing unit
US7847800B2 (en) * 2004-04-16 2010-12-07 Apple Inc. System for emulating graphics operations
US8704837B2 (en) * 2004-04-16 2014-04-22 Apple Inc. High-level program interface for graphics operations
US7636489B2 (en) * 2004-04-16 2009-12-22 Apple Inc. Blur computation algorithm
US7231632B2 (en) * 2004-04-16 2007-06-12 Apple Computer, Inc. System for reducing the number of programs necessary to render an image
US8134561B2 (en) 2004-04-16 2012-03-13 Apple Inc. System for optimizing graphics operations
US7397964B2 (en) * 2004-06-24 2008-07-08 Apple Inc. Gaussian blur approximation suitable for GPU
US8130237B2 (en) * 2004-06-24 2012-03-06 Apple Inc. Resolution independent user interface design
US8068103B2 (en) * 2004-06-24 2011-11-29 Apple Inc. User-interface design
US7761800B2 (en) 2004-06-25 2010-07-20 Apple Inc. Unified interest layer for user interface
US8239749B2 (en) 2004-06-25 2012-08-07 Apple Inc. Procedurally expressing graphic objects for web pages
US7652678B2 (en) * 2004-06-25 2010-01-26 Apple Inc. Partial display updates in a windowing system using a programmable graphics processing unit
US8302020B2 (en) 2004-06-25 2012-10-30 Apple Inc. Widget authoring and editing environment
US8566732B2 (en) 2004-06-25 2013-10-22 Apple Inc. Synchronization of widgets and dashboards
US8453065B2 (en) 2004-06-25 2013-05-28 Apple Inc. Preview and installation of user interface elements in a display environment
US7490295B2 (en) 2004-06-25 2009-02-10 Apple Inc. Layer for accessing user interface elements
US7546543B2 (en) 2004-06-25 2009-06-09 Apple Inc. Widget authoring and editing environment
US20050285866A1 (en) * 2004-06-25 2005-12-29 Apple Computer, Inc. Display-wide visual effects for a windowing system using a programmable graphics processing unit
US7227551B2 (en) * 2004-12-23 2007-06-05 Apple Inc. Manipulating text and graphic appearance
US8140975B2 (en) 2005-01-07 2012-03-20 Apple Inc. Slide show navigation
US8543931B2 (en) 2005-06-07 2013-09-24 Apple Inc. Preview including theme based installation of user interface elements in a display environment
CN1322414C (en) * 2005-06-23 2007-06-20 北京中星微电子有限公司 Frame buffer storage control device and image data transmission system and method
CN100444581C (en) * 2005-08-31 2008-12-17 北京中星微电子有限公司 Special interface and image data transmission system and method
US7752556B2 (en) 2005-10-27 2010-07-06 Apple Inc. Workflow widgets
US7743336B2 (en) 2005-10-27 2010-06-22 Apple Inc. Widget security
US7954064B2 (en) 2005-10-27 2011-05-31 Apple Inc. Multiple dashboards
US9104294B2 (en) 2005-10-27 2015-08-11 Apple Inc. Linked widgets
US8543824B2 (en) 2005-10-27 2013-09-24 Apple Inc. Safe distribution and use of content
US7707514B2 (en) 2005-11-18 2010-04-27 Apple Inc. Management of user interface elements in a display environment
US8869027B2 (en) 2006-08-04 2014-10-21 Apple Inc. Management and generation of dashboards
US8954871B2 (en) 2007-07-18 2015-02-10 Apple Inc. User-centric widgets and dashboards
US8667415B2 (en) 2007-08-06 2014-03-04 Apple Inc. Web widgets
US8156467B2 (en) 2007-08-27 2012-04-10 Adobe Systems Incorporated Reusing components in a running application
US8411740B2 (en) * 2007-09-10 2013-04-02 Ncomputing Inc. System and method for low bandwidth display information transport
US8176466B2 (en) 2007-10-01 2012-05-08 Adobe Systems Incorporated System and method for generating an application fragment
US9619304B2 (en) 2008-02-05 2017-04-11 Adobe Systems Incorporated Automatic connections between application components
US8656293B1 (en) 2008-07-29 2014-02-18 Adobe Systems Incorporated Configuring mobile devices
CN102577408B (en) * 2009-09-30 2015-04-15 夏普株式会社 Reproduction method using information recording medium, information recording/reproduction device, and 3d conversion unit and information recording device
US9215448B2 (en) * 2013-01-31 2015-12-15 Here Global B.V. Stereo panoramic images
JP2020149174A (en) * 2019-03-12 2020-09-17 ソニー株式会社 Image processing apparatus, image processing method, and program
CN110441768B (en) * 2019-09-09 2021-06-18 北京工业大学 System for rapidly extracting ice surface and bedrock interface in Antarctic aviation ice radar data

Family Cites Families (27)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4580134A (en) * 1982-11-16 1986-04-01 Real Time Design, Inc. Color video system using data compression and decompression
JPS628193A (en) * 1985-07-04 1987-01-16 インタ−ナショナル ビジネス マシ−ンズ コ−ポレ−ション Color image display system
US4823120A (en) * 1986-09-12 1989-04-18 Apple Computer, Inc. Enhanced video graphics controller
US4743959A (en) * 1986-09-17 1988-05-10 Frederiksen Jeffrey E High resolution color video image acquisition and compression system
US4811124A (en) * 1987-07-24 1989-03-07 Advanced Micro Devices, Inc. Defect skipping mechanism for disk drives
US4935879A (en) * 1987-08-05 1990-06-19 Daikin Industries, Ltd. Texture mapping apparatus and method
US5025249A (en) * 1988-06-13 1991-06-18 Digital Equipment Corporation Pixel lookup in multiple variably-sized hardware virtual colormaps in a computer video graphics system
US5128658A (en) * 1988-06-27 1992-07-07 Digital Equipment Corporation Pixel data formatting
US5175806A (en) * 1989-03-28 1992-12-29 Computer Design, Inc. Method and apparatus for fast surface detail application to an image
US5091717A (en) * 1989-05-01 1992-02-25 Sun Microsystems, Inc. Apparatus for selecting mode of output in a computer system
US5224208A (en) * 1990-03-16 1993-06-29 Hewlett-Packard Company Gradient calculation for texture mapping
JP2602344B2 (en) * 1990-06-04 1997-04-23 シャープ株式会社 Image synthesis device
US5629720A (en) * 1991-02-05 1997-05-13 Hewlett-Packard Company Display mode processor
US5307450A (en) * 1991-02-19 1994-04-26 Silicon Graphics, Inc. Z-subdivision for improved texture mapping
JP2950346B2 (en) * 1991-03-25 1999-09-20 ソニー株式会社 Image data decoding method and its decoder circuit
JP3158370B2 (en) * 1991-07-12 2001-04-23 ソニー株式会社 Disc data playback device
DE69223489T2 (en) * 1991-09-09 1998-07-16 Sun Microsystems Inc Device and method for managing the assignment of identification values of display attributes and of several hardware color tables
US5291468A (en) * 1991-09-16 1994-03-01 International Business Machines Corporation Method and apparatus for synchronizing the readout of a sequential media device with a separate clocked device
GB2275401B (en) * 1991-12-18 1995-11-01 Pfu Ltd A graphic coloring system in a graphic display system
JP2793463B2 (en) * 1992-04-28 1998-09-03 インターナショナル・ビジネス・マシーンズ・コーポレイション Color set selection apparatus and method, and color selection management method
GB2270243B (en) * 1992-08-26 1996-02-28 Namco Ltd Image synthesizing system
JP2583003B2 (en) * 1992-09-11 1997-02-19 インターナショナル・ビジネス・マシーンズ・コーポレイション Image display method, frame buffer, and graphics display system in graphics display system
JPH06111495A (en) * 1992-09-30 1994-04-22 Sony Corp Device for reproducing data
US5319793A (en) * 1992-10-21 1994-06-07 International Business Machines Corporation Method and apparatus for improved compression and recording of color video data in a personal computer using a plurality of lookup tables
CA2103395C (en) * 1992-11-24 2004-08-17 Masakazu Suzuoki Apparatus and method for providing texture of a moving image to a surface of an object to be displayed
JP3243883B2 (en) * 1993-04-12 2002-01-07 ソニー株式会社 Recording or playback device
US5757376A (en) * 1994-12-02 1998-05-26 Sony Corporation Method of producing image data and associated recording medium

Cited By (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N110660029A (en) * 2019-09-12 2020-01-07 深兰科技(上海)有限公司 Image processing method, device, equipment and storage medium

Also Published As

Publication number Publication date
CN1132887A (en) 1996-10-09
EP0715279A2 (en) 1996-06-05
ATE281675T1 (en) 2004-11-15
CA2164269C (en) 2008-02-12
KR100392808B1 (en) 2003-11-10
CN1136517C (en) 2004-01-28
EP0715279B1 (en) 2004-11-03
EP0715279A3 (en) 1997-02-26
KR960025236A (en) 1996-07-20
US5949409A (en) 1999-09-07

Similar Documents

Publication Publication Date Title
CA2164269A1 (en) Image processing in which the image is divided into image areas with specific color lookup tables for enhanced color resolution
US6172669B1 (en) Method and apparatus for translation and storage of multiple data formats in a display system
US5481275A (en) Resolution enhancement for video display using multi-line interpolation
EP0752695B1 (en) Method and apparatus for simultaneously displaying graphics and video data on a computer display
TW342484B (en) Illumination and shadow simulation in a computer graphics/imaging system
CA2121672A1 (en) Scalable three-dimensional borders
EP0322106A3 (en) Display device
WO2002041251A3 (en) Dynamically allocating a frame buffer for anti-aliasing
EP0715278A3 (en)
GB2153638A (en) Method and apparatus for assigning color values to bit map memory display locations
CA2191617A1 (en) System for displaying calligraphic video on raster displays
GB2165728A (en) Improvements in video image creation
ATE308202T1 (en) MIXING A GRAPHIC SIGNAL WITH A VIDEO SIGNAL
TW376669B (en) Color graphic processor
JPH06314085A (en) Image processing system
CA2217750A1 (en) Cluster dot halftoning system
JPS59205881A (en) Electronic still memory system
CA2339608A1 (en) Image display apparatus
EP1030269A3 (en) Image display method, image processing system, and recording medium
CA2165650A1 (en) Low Latency Update of Graphic Objects in an Air Traffic Control Display
CA2385906A1 (en) Mixed resolution displays
EP0319684A3 (en) Display system for color image quantization
CA2024745A1 (en) Beamformer for matrix display
JPS6251388U (en)
TH22905B (en) Image data production methods, image data production equipment, and recording media

Legal Events

Date Code Title Description
EEER Examination request
MKEX Expiry

Effective date: 20151201